Synopsis:
John Helliker directed this Canadian comedy. Toronto hustler Cheryl (Megan Follows), artist wannabe from a small town, is in a car with boyfriend Jason (James Gallanders) when they literally bump into drunken Donald (Jaimz Woolvett). Minus Jason, she takes Donald back to his seedy apartment to see if he's okay and stays over. When dawn arrives, a relationship begins -- as Donald proclaims her the angel who has rescued him. Shown at the 1997 Vancouver Film Festival.

Comedy set in Toronto. While driving, Cheryl's boyfriend, Jason, accidently knocks over Donald who is drunk. Cheryl takes him back to his flat and ends up staying the night. When Donald wakes up he believes he has been rescued by an angel. He couldn't be more wrong. Flier tagline: Sometimes angels aren't really angels.

Toronto hustler Cheryl and her boyfriend, Jason, run over nerdy Donald who is, as usual, drunk. Without Jason's help, Cheryl drags the drunken Donald back to his crummy apartment to make sure he's okay. When Donald awakes, he believes he has been saved by an angel. Although not a "real" angel, Cheryl decides to make a test case out of Donald in order to help him find his true potential.
